David Kent Invitational Day 1 Results

COLLEGE STATION, Texas – Members of the Texas A&M women's tennis team went a combined 8-4 on the first day of the inaugural David Kent Invitational at the George P. Mitchell Tennis Center.
 
Texas A&M opened the competition by winning three of four doubles matches. At the No. 1 doubles flight, A&M seniors Rutuja Bhosale and Rachel Pierson never trailed as they raced to a 6-2 victory over Katherine Ip and Priya Niezgoda of Rice. At the No. 2 flight, the duo of Dominica Gonzalez and Eva Paalma let a 5-3 lead slip away in a 7-5 loss to Wendy Zhang and Alison Ho of Rice. The Aggies notched a win at the No. 3 flight as Tina Bokhua and Stefania Hristov jumped out to a 5-0 lead en route to a 6-2 victory over Savannah Durkin and Fernanda Astete of Rice, and at the No. 4 flight, A&M's Mason Strickland and Macarena Olivares fought back from a 5-1 deficit against Denise Maxl and Kaja Ljubia of Stephen F. Austin, winning six consecutive games to win the match, 7-5.
 
Singles had just begun when the on-and-off drizzle and rain began, hampering play throughout the day. When play finally completed in the early evening, A&M had come out victorious in five of singles eight flights.
 
Pierson cruised to a 6-2, 6-1 straight-set victory over Stacey Fung of Washington at the No. 1 flight, and Bhosale picked up a 6-3, 6-1 win over the Huskies' Miki Kobayahsi at the No. 2 flight. Aggie newcomer Bokhua suffered a 6-3, 6-1 setback against Alexis Prokopuik of Washington at the No. 3 flight, while another newcomer, Olivares defeated Nour Abbes of Washington, 6-4, 6-2 at the No. 4 flight. A&M also picked up a victory at the No. 5 flight as fifth-year senior Hristov toppled Washington's Kenadi Hance, 6-3, 6-4. Gonzalez suffered a 7-6, 0-6, 6-3 loss to Kat Kopcalic of Washington at the No. 6 flight, and Paalma posted a 6-1, 6-1 win over Lana Slavica of Washington at the No. 7 singles flight. At the No. 8 flight, A&M's Strickland fell to Kaja Ljubic of Stephen F. Austin, 6-1, 1-6, 6-3.

The tournament is named in honor of David Kent, who had a long and illustrious career as the Texas A&M men's tennis coach from 1979-96, recording the most wins in program history. A member of the Intercollegiate Tennis Association Men's Tennis Hall of Fame and the Texas A&M Athletic Hall of Fame, Kent coached current Aggie women's tennis head coach Mark Weaver from 1990-94. Kent, who also coached the Texas A&M women's tennis team in 1980, passed away Nov. 3, 2015, at the age of 80.
